Job description

Responsibilities
  • Provides maintenance engineering support to the Maintenance division and other CMBC departments on matters relating to the safe, efficient and cost‑effective repair and overhaul of fleet vehicles.
  • Ensures fleet vehicles comply with provincial and federal standards and that related equipment is certified and approved by WorkSafeBC or other regulatory bodies.
  • Assists Maintenance Engineers, technical support staff, and supervisory personnel on a variety of maintenance engineering projects, studies, test programs and evaluations related to vehicles, components, tooling, test and diagnostic equipment, and associated infrastructure, under the direct supervision of a Professional Engineer (P.Eng.) registered in British Columbia.
  • Provides project‑management support for bus procurement projects on behalf of CMBC.
  • Assists the Warranty Administrator on various claim issues.
  • Liaises with vendors to discuss equipment or component failures or problems.
  • Liaises with various transit properties and outside agencies concerning matters of mutual concern and gives presentations at seminars and conferences as required.
Education & Qualifications
  • University degree in Engineering (appropriate discipline) from a recognized institution.
  • Engineer‑in‑Training designation from Engineers and Geoscientists BC (EGBC).
Experience
  • Six (6) months in a heavy‑equipment or industrial environment related to commercial or heavy‑duty vehicle maintenance repair.
  • One (1) year in the position required to become familiar with CMBC policies and procedures.
Work Schedule & Designation
  • Resident – works predominantly on‑site.
  • 37.5 hours per week.
Rate of Pay & Benefits
  • Salary: $85,836 – $103,417 per annum (actual salary commensurate with education, experience and internal parity).
  • Extended health, dental and transit pass.
  • Public Service Pension Plan enrollment.
  • Tuition reimbursement, training and mentorship programs.
  • Health and wellness programs, including access to gym facilities.
